Bitwise Chief Investment Officer Matt Hougan has weighed in on the growing debate over Digital Asset Treasuries (DATs). He argues that only companies executing complex, value-adding crypto strategies deserve to trade at a premium. The comments come amid a sharp revaluation in the DAT sector. Most firms’ market net asset values (mNAVs) have converged toward 1. 0. Matt Hougan (@Matt_Hougan) November 5, 2025 Hougan distinguishes companies that buy and hold crypto assets and those that actively build financial structures or strategic models around their holdings. “Buying a crypto asset and putting it on a balance sheet today isn’t hard,” he said, adding that ETFs now offer staking options that replicate the same exposure with lower friction. He singled out MicroStrategy (now Strategy) as the standout example of a DAT executing a difficult but rewarding strategy.
